J'ai beaucoup de fichiers WAV que je ne souhaite pas importer dans iTunes pour les convertir. Il y a trop. Je voudrais un moyen de les convertir en Apple sans perte dans le terminal avant de les importer sur iTunes.
10
Vous devrez faire une boucle bash for dans un script (ou xargs
) mais la commande en question qui vous intéresse est:
afconvert -d alac in.wav out.m4a
Plus d'informations peuvent être trouvées en exécutant man afconvert
ou afconvert -h
.
for file in *.wav; do afconvert -d alac "$file" "${file%wav}m4a"; done
afconvert
a une gamme assez limitée de formats d'entrée, je suggère d'utiliserffmpeg
également l'encodeur intégré alac mais prend en charge des tonnes de formats audio et il essaie également de garder les métadonnées de la source autant que possible. par exempleffmpeg -i input.whatever -vn -c:a alac -f ipod output.m4a